Ensuring a safe and secure environment is crucial in any setting. Common spaces, particularly those with vulnerable populations, require extra consideration to minimize potential dangers. One often overlooked aspect is the design of notice boards.

Standard notice boards can pose a serious risk due to their visible fasteners and mounting hardware. These elements can become tools that may be used for suspicious activities, creating a unsafe situation.

  • To mitigate this risk, anti-ligature notice boards have been designed. These specialized boards employ strong materials and ingenious designs to eliminate potential ligature sites.
  • Firmly mounted with tamper-proof fixings, these boards prevent the use of cords for suspension.
  • Additionally, anti-ligature notice boards are often designed to be easy cleaning and maintenance, minimizing the risk of infection.

Selecting anti-ligature notice boards demonstrates a responsibility to creating a safe and welcoming environment for all.

Preventing Risk with Anti-Ligature Bulletin Boards

Forming a secure environment within facilities is paramount for your safety and well-being. Bulletin boards can act as vital communication tools, but they can also present potential hazards if not properly selected and secured. Anti-ligature bulletin boards are built to mitigate these risks by eliminating the possibility of items being used for harmful purposes.

These specialized boards feature heavy-duty materials and designs that restrict the capacity to attach or hang objects, thus reducing the risk of ligature attempts.

By choosing anti-ligature bulletin boards, you can guarantee a safer and more secure environment for everyone.

Advanced Safety in Shared Spaces: Anti-Ligature Noticeboards

Creating secure environments within shared spaces is paramount. To achieve this goal, many facilities are implementing anti-ligature noticeboards. These unique boards feature sturdy materials that resist tampering and prevent the use of objects for ligature risks. By eliminating these potential hazards, anti-ligature noticeboards play a crucial role in ensuring the well-being of individuals within correctional facilities and other shared settings.

Moreover, these boards often incorporate functional designs that allow for clear information sharing.

  • Illustrations of these features include:
  • Locked message slots
  • Durable mounting techniques
  • Weather-resistant surfaces for external use

By utilizing anti-ligature noticeboards, institutions can affirm their commitment to creating safe and nurturing environments for all.
